Project Number Date
test_Tails_ISO_devel 4220 09 Feb 2026, 18:33

Feature Report

Steps Scenarios Features
Feature Passed Failed Skipped Pending Undefined Total Passed Failed Total Duration Status
Localization 242 0 0 0 0 242 21 0 21 27:30.173 Passed
Tags: @product
Feature Localization
As a Tails user I want Tails to be localized in my native language And various Tails features should still work
Tags: @product
50.271
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 8.851
And I log in to a new session in German (de) 25.290
Then the live user's Documents directory exists 0.040
And there is a GNOME bookmark for the Documents directory 16.088
After features/support/hooks.rb:331 1.389
After features/support/hooks.rb:100 0.000
Tags: @product
48.548
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.004
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.559
And I log in to a new session in German (de) 24.844
Then the live user's Downloads directory exists 0.054
And there is a GNOME bookmark for the Downloads directory 16.090
After features/support/hooks.rb:331 0.840
After features/support/hooks.rb:100 0.000
Tags: @product
49.298
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.002
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 8.049
And I log in to a new session in German (de) 25.583
Then the live user's Music directory exists 0.047
And there is a GNOME bookmark for the Music directory 15.618
After features/support/hooks.rb:331 1.307
After features/support/hooks.rb:100 0.000
Tags: @product
48.460
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.480
And I log in to a new session in German (de) 25.137
Then the live user's Pictures directory exists 0.041
And there is a GNOME bookmark for the Pictures directory 15.799
After features/support/hooks.rb:331 0.960
After features/support/hooks.rb:100 0.000
Tags: @product
48.847
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.002
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.729
And I log in to a new session in German (de) 25.192
Then the live user's Videos directory exists 0.064
And there is a GNOME bookmark for the Videos directory 15.860
After features/support/hooks.rb:331 1.271
After features/support/hooks.rb:100 0.000
1:54.430
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.004
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.582
When I log in to a new session in Arabic (ar) 24.525
Then the keyboard layout is set to "eg" 0.146
And tpsd is localized to the selected locale 0.165
When the network is plugged 0.025
And Tor is ready 42.244
Then I successfully start the Unsafe Browser 5.778
And I kill the Unsafe Browser 5.389
When I enable the screen keyboard 0.069
Then the screen keyboard works in Tor Browser 12.441
And DuckDuckGo is the default search engine 5.453
And I kill the Tor Browser 5.205
And the screen keyboard works in Thunderbird 4.992
And the layout of the screen keyboard is set to "us" 0.409
After features/support/hooks.rb:331 1.478
After features/support/hooks.rb:100 0.000
1:20.406
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.431
When I log in to a new session in Chinese (zh_CN) 24.121
Then the keyboard layout is set to "cn" 0.089
And tpsd is localized to the selected locale 0.334
When the network is plugged 0.015
And Tor is ready 13.474
Then I successfully start the Unsafe Browser 5.307
And I kill the Unsafe Browser 5.201
When I enable the screen keyboard 0.092
Then the screen keyboard works in Tor Browser 8.638
And DuckDuckGo is the default search engine 5.094
And I kill the Tor Browser 5.212
And the screen keyboard works in Thunderbird 5.028
And the layout of the screen keyboard is set to "us" 0.365
After features/support/hooks.rb:331 1.219
After features/support/hooks.rb:100 0.000
1:4.927
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.437
When I log in to a new session in English (en) 10.814
Then the keyboard layout is set to "us" 0.093
And tpsd is localized to the selected locale 0.089
When the network is plugged 0.016
And Tor is ready 13.043
Then I successfully start the Unsafe Browser 5.769
And I kill the Unsafe Browser 5.332
When I enable the screen keyboard 0.059
Then the screen keyboard works in Tor Browser 7.858
And DuckDuckGo is the default search engine 3.891
And I kill the Tor Browser 5.212
And the screen keyboard works in Thunderbird 4.899
And the layout of the screen keyboard is set to "us" 0.408
After features/support/hooks.rb:331 1.417
After features/support/hooks.rb:100 0.000
1:21.917
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.004
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.651
When I log in to a new session in French (fr) 25.256
Then the keyboard layout is set to "fr" 0.135
And tpsd is localized to the selected locale 0.081
When the network is plugged 0.016
And Tor is ready 13.667
Then I successfully start the Unsafe Browser 5.711
And I kill the Unsafe Browser 5.290
When I enable the screen keyboard 0.061
Then the screen keyboard works in Tor Browser 8.116
And DuckDuckGo is the default search engine 5.816
And I kill the Tor Browser 5.233
And the screen keyboard works in Thunderbird 4.439
And the layout of the screen keyboard is set to "fr" 0.439
After features/support/hooks.rb:331 1.430
After features/support/hooks.rb:100 0.000
1:20.165
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.004
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.416
When I log in to a new session in German (de) 24.715
Then the keyboard layout is set to "de" 0.179
And tpsd is localized to the selected locale 0.103
When the network is plugged 0.016
And Tor is ready 12.738
Then I successfully start the Unsafe Browser 5.738
And I kill the Unsafe Browser 5.219
When I enable the screen keyboard 0.061
Then the screen keyboard works in Tor Browser 8.508
And DuckDuckGo is the default search engine 5.437
And I kill the Tor Browser 5.240
And the screen keyboard works in Thunderbird 4.413
And the layout of the screen keyboard is set to "de" 0.376
After features/support/hooks.rb:331 0.704
After features/support/hooks.rb:100 0.000
1:54.659
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.004
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.570
When I log in to a new session in Hindi (hi) 25.659
Then the keyboard layout is set to "in" 0.084
And tpsd is localized to the selected locale 0.087
When the network is plugged 0.018
And Tor is ready 43.278
Then I successfully start the Unsafe Browser 5.406
And I kill the Unsafe Browser 5.229
When I enable the screen keyboard 0.057
Then the screen keyboard works in Tor Browser 11.781
And DuckDuckGo is the default search engine 5.174
And I kill the Tor Browser 5.253
And the screen keyboard works in Thunderbird 4.688
And the layout of the screen keyboard is set to "us" 0.369
After features/support/hooks.rb:331 1.206
After features/support/hooks.rb:100 0.000
1:21.391
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.535
When I log in to a new session in Indonesian (id) 24.870
Then the keyboard layout is set to "id" 0.128
And tpsd is localized to the selected locale 0.096
When the network is plugged 0.047
And Tor is ready 13.814
Then I successfully start the Unsafe Browser 5.642
And I kill the Unsafe Browser 5.205
When I enable the screen keyboard 0.064
Then the screen keyboard works in Tor Browser 7.571
And DuckDuckGo is the default search engine 6.119
And I kill the Tor Browser 5.239
And the screen keyboard works in Thunderbird 4.678
And the layout of the screen keyboard is set to "us" 0.376
After features/support/hooks.rb:331 1.242
After features/support/hooks.rb:100 0.000
1:23.401
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.308
When I log in to a new session in Italian (it) 25.549
Then the keyboard layout is set to "it" 0.163
And tpsd is localized to the selected locale 0.097
When the network is plugged 0.019
And Tor is ready 13.900
Then I successfully start the Unsafe Browser 5.581
And I kill the Unsafe Browser 5.259
When I enable the screen keyboard 0.052
Then the screen keyboard works in Tor Browser 8.671
And DuckDuckGo is the default search engine 5.861
And I kill the Tor Browser 5.263
And the screen keyboard works in Thunderbird 5.037
And the layout of the screen keyboard is set to "us" 0.634
After features/support/hooks.rb:331 1.525
After features/support/hooks.rb:100 0.000
1:21.576
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.004
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.577
When I log in to a new session in Persian (fa) 25.162
Then the keyboard layout is set to "ir" 0.109
And tpsd is localized to the selected locale 0.091
When the network is plugged 0.016
And Tor is ready 12.758
Then I successfully start the Unsafe Browser 5.447
And I kill the Unsafe Browser 5.195
When I enable the screen keyboard 0.060
Then the screen keyboard works in Tor Browser 8.896
And DuckDuckGo is the default search engine 5.412
And I kill the Tor Browser 5.217
And the screen keyboard works in Thunderbird 5.273
And the layout of the screen keyboard is set to "ir" 0.356
After features/support/hooks.rb:331 1.024
After features/support/hooks.rb:100 0.000
1:19.618
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.002
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.217
When I log in to a new session in Portuguese (pt) 24.317
Then the keyboard layout is set to "pt" 0.128
And tpsd is localized to the selected locale 0.105
When the network is plugged 0.020
And Tor is ready 12.932
Then I successfully start the Unsafe Browser 4.716
And I kill the Unsafe Browser 5.195
When I enable the screen keyboard 0.058
Then the screen keyboard works in Tor Browser 8.878
And DuckDuckGo is the default search engine 5.369
And I kill the Tor Browser 5.229
And the screen keyboard works in Thunderbird 4.989
And the layout of the screen keyboard is set to "us" 0.458
After features/support/hooks.rb:331 0.975
After features/support/hooks.rb:100 0.000
1:23.065
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.334
When I log in to a new session in Russian (ru) 24.720
Then the keyboard layout is set to "ru" 0.104
And tpsd is localized to the selected locale 0.083
When the network is plugged 0.016
And Tor is ready 12.635
Then I successfully start the Unsafe Browser 4.797
And I kill the Unsafe Browser 5.207
When I enable the screen keyboard 0.057
Then the screen keyboard works in Tor Browser 12.384
And DuckDuckGo is the default search engine 5.383
And I kill the Tor Browser 5.194
And the screen keyboard works in Thunderbird 4.792
And the layout of the screen keyboard is set to "ru" 0.352
After features/support/hooks.rb:331 1.193
After features/support/hooks.rb:100 0.000
1:18.477
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.447
When I log in to a new session in Spanish (es) 24.152
Then the keyboard layout is set to "es" 0.097
And tpsd is localized to the selected locale 0.121
When the network is plugged 0.019
And Tor is ready 13.386
Then I successfully start the Unsafe Browser 5.162
And I kill the Unsafe Browser 5.201
When I enable the screen keyboard 0.051
Then the screen keyboard works in Tor Browser 7.692
And DuckDuckGo is the default search engine 4.835
And I kill the Tor Browser 5.258
And the screen keyboard works in Thunderbird 4.620
And the layout of the screen keyboard is set to "us" 0.429
After features/support/hooks.rb:331 1.298
After features/support/hooks.rb:100 0.000
1:18.012
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.002
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.279
When I log in to a new session in Turkish (tr) 24.306
Then the keyboard layout is set to "tr" 0.116
And tpsd is localized to the selected locale 0.134
When the network is plugged 0.016
And Tor is ready 13.067
Then I successfully start the Unsafe Browser 4.794
And I kill the Unsafe Browser 5.191
When I enable the screen keyboard 0.092
Then the screen keyboard works in Tor Browser 7.565
And DuckDuckGo is the default search engine 4.891
And I kill the Tor Browser 5.203
And the screen keyboard works in Thunderbird 4.953
And the layout of the screen keyboard is set to "us" 0.398
After features/support/hooks.rb:331 1.239
After features/support/hooks.rb:100 0.000
Tags: @product
1:3.878
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.004
Given I have started Tails without network from a USB drive without a persistent partition and stopped at Tails Greeter's login screen 8.638
When I set the language to Italian (it) 4.804
Then the language and keyboard have not been saved in cleartext storage 2.080
When I shutdown Tails and wait for the computer to power off 6.947
And I start Tails from USB drive "__internal" with network unplugged 41.145
Then the Welcome Screen's language is set to English 0.262
After features/support/hooks.rb:331 1.308
After features/support/hooks.rb:100 0.007
Tags: @product
1:18.647
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.003
Given I have started Tails without network from a USB drive without a persistent partition and stopped at Tails Greeter's login screen 8.248
When I set the language to Italian (it) 4.657
And I save the language and keyboard options in cleartext storage 2.483
Then the "it" language and keyboard have been saved in cleartext storage 0.093
When I set the language to French (fr) 4.481
Then the "fr" language and keyboard have been saved in cleartext storage 0.096
And I shutdown Tails and wait for the computer to power off 5.755
And I start Tails from USB drive "__internal" with network unplugged 43.118
Then the "fr" language and keyboard have been saved in cleartext storage 0.351
And the Welcome Screen's language is set to French 0.826
When I log in to a new session 8.487
Then the language is set to French 0.046
After features/support/hooks.rb:331 0.600
After features/support/hooks.rb:100 0.008
Tags: @product
2:40.170
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.003
Given I have started Tails without network from a USB drive without a persistent partition and logged in 8.579
# The first boot simulates a legacy Tails, where locale is only saved in Persistent Storage
Then Tails is running from USB drive "__internal" 0.329
And I create a persistent partition 29.844
And I manually store legacy localization settings in Persistent Storage 0.582
When I shutdown Tails and wait for the computer to power off 9.520
# The second boot verifies that the legacy setting still works
And I start Tails from USB drive "__internal" with network unplugged 38.980
Then the Welcome Screen's language is set to English 0.289
And the Welcome Screen's formats is set to United States 0.265
When I enable persistence 8.065
Then the Welcome Screen's language is set to German 0.535
And the Welcome Screen's formats is set to France 0.238
When I set the language to Italian (it) 4.460
Then the language and keyboard have not been saved in cleartext storage 2.101
When I save the language and keyboard options in cleartext storage 2.480
Then the "it" language and keyboard have been saved in cleartext storage 0.090
And I shutdown Tails and wait for the computer to power off 4.517
# The third boot verifies that cleartext has priority
And I start Tails from USB drive "__internal" with network unplugged 37.773
Then the Welcome Screen's language is set to Italian 0.682
And the Welcome Screen's formats is set to Italy 0.268
When I enable persistence 9.719
# Only formats are loaded from persistence
Then the Welcome Screen's formats is set to France 0.156
And the Welcome Screen's language is set to Italian 0.687
After features/support/hooks.rb:331 0.544
After features/support/hooks.rb:100 0.010